    Lever lock on Burke & James View Camera

    I have a Burke & James 5 x 7 commercial view camera. It has a lever lock feature to secure the rear standard in place. It doesn’t work. I can’t figure out how to repair it and I’m wondering if anyone here knows of somebody who might work on something like this? Or any idea for how I might repair it?

    Re: Lever lock on Burke & James View Camera

    The twin levers create a locking action with simple cams. If you remove the back standard and unbolt the plate that covers the cross rail, it will expose the workings. Perhaps your cams have worn down such that they no longer create a binding friction. Looking at my own 5X7 Burke and James, from underneath where there's a limited view with out unassembling the works, I'm unable to determine how the cams are attached to the spanning rod. For all I know they may have a set screw, spot welded, or press-fitted. Once you taken it apart it should be easy to determine the problem.
